Title: **Innovative Contributions of Basudeb Saha**
Introduction
Basudeb Saha is an esteemed inventor located in London, GB. He has made significant advancements in the field of chemical engineering, particularly with his contributions to epoxidation processes. With a portfolio of 2 patents, Saha exemplifies the spirit of innovation in his field.
Latest Patents
Among his notable inventions is a patent for a Liquid Phase Epoxidation Process. This continuous process enhances the epoxidation of olefinic compounds utilizing an oxidant. The process is characterized by the reaction of olefinic compounds with an oxidant, facilitated by a catalyst within a specialized apparatus. This invention has the potential to improve efficiencies in chemical manufacturing.
Career Highlights
Basudeb Saha is associated with South Bank University Enterprises Limited, where he contributes his expertise to research and development initiatives. His role within this institution highlights his commitment to advancing chemical engineering practices through innovative solutions.
Collaborations
Saha has collaborated with distinguished colleagues such as Krzysztof Ambroziak and David Colin Sherrington. Together, they work on pioneering projects that push the boundaries of existing technologies and methodologies.
